DP Sought Removal From the Agenda; Majority Rejects the Request on the Magistrates’ Bill

Parliament has rejected the Democratic Party’s request to remove from the agenda the bill on the status of judges and prosecutors, which foresees changes related to magistrates’ pay. The opposition’s request was put to a vote in plenary session and was rejected with 36 votes in favor and 79 against. The DP had asked that the bill not be reviewed in today’s session, but be sent for assessment to the Council for Legislation. Democratic parliamentary group leader Gazment Bardhi argued during his speech in Parliament that the issue of magistrates’ status is directly linked to guaranteeing the independence of the justice system.

Bardhi said this issue has been carried over for seven years and that three decisions have been issued on it by the Constitutional Court, while accusing the majority of not implementing the two previous decisions.

“Withdraw this bill from the agenda, because you risk violating the Constitution again,” Bardhi declared. He asked Parliament to take the necessary time to discuss with justice bodies and magistrates’ associations, with the aim of finding a final solution.

“It is unimaginable for the justice system to be under the majority’s pressure for seven years,” said the DP parliamentary group leader.

On the other hand, Socialist parliamentary group leader Taulant Balla declared that the bill will continue the parliamentary procedure and will be voted on. Balla said the Council for Legislation has completed its task in an exemplary manner, countering the opposition’s argument for sending the bill back for review.

He also referred to the Constitutional Court, saying the decision on the matter in question was taken in mid-February, while it was published at the end of April. After the rejection of the DP’s request, the bill on the status of judges and prosecutors remains on Parliament’s agenda for review and voting.
